Arrigo BMS is equipped with a robust API for easy import and export of data from different systems. Via the open API, Arrigo BMS makes all data available and can be integrated with several external systems such as hotel booking services, business systems, etc. Collected data can be used either directly in Arrigo BMS or in other systems that are connected via the open API.

Thanks to simple technology based on graphQL/REST and encrypted transfer, you can add and delete information, read and write values, and retrieve information, history, saved data, and real-time data. You can also connect via websocket directly to Arrigo's backbone and write your own extensions, which can be retrieved via server-side functions.

Third-party integration.

Users can easily integrate with controllers from any manufacturer via OPC. To retrieve data from third-party systems to connected controllers, integration can be done through various interfaces such as Modbus, BACnet and Mbus. Anyone working with Arrigo BMS can aggregate data in a flexible way, regardless of the source.

Charts, data logging
and real-time trends.

In Arrigo, you can easily track historical information to make informed decisions. Users can choose between analog and digital signals. These are displayed as a trend in a historical graph window. Depending on the type of signal, historical data logging can be done in the following ways:

  • Time logging for each individual logged variable: fixed intervals, normally used for analog values.
  • Event-based logging: logged only when a status change occurs, typically used for digital signals and alarm signals.
  • Real-time logging: Logged when the signal is displayed in the historical graph window. Logging is updated continuously and is lost when the window is closed. Real-time logging can be used with any signal in Arrigo BMS.

The chart makes it easy to view, zoom, scroll and export data. In addition, the work done can be saved to be continued at a later time, either as personal work or as “global” work.

Alarm handling

Complete alarm management.

A common challenge for operations managers is that they do not receive enough information when alarms are generated by a property's BMS. Being able to deduce the cause of the alarm and take the right action as quickly as possible is crucial to reducing the number of alarms or downtime in the long term.

Arrigo is the platform that manages property data from multiple sources. Via Modbus, BACnet, M-Bus and OPC, Arrigo communicates with control units and field products in the system and alerts immediately if something is wrong.

Arrigo offers efficient functions for structuring and coordinating alarms, while also ensuring that the right roles are informed, so that the right actions can be taken immediately.

Alarm functions in Arrigo:

  • Alarm widgets provide access to alarm history and relevant information in real time.
  • Configurable runtime tools to quickly determine alarm type and location, with options for quick analysis and action, such as acknowledgement, blocking, etc.
  • Large number of filter options.
  • Ability to add alarms to historical charts.

Reports.

Clear reports are a must for sustainable property automation. Arrigo generates its reports based on advanced data processing and analysis functions. All property data in the application can be used to generate a report, for example:

  • Data from field products (e.g. a controller)
  • Properties from system resources
  • Search results
  • Historical data logs or events
  • Script-generated data

Working with reports is a very good strategy for continuously reducing the number of alarms and making energy use more efficient in a property. Arrigo can also serve as an important tool for prioritizing operation and maintenance work.

Reports can be exported in various formats, including CSV and PDF, and can also be sent via email. Reports can also be generated manually, on specific events, or on a schedule.

Script.

For customers working with custom customizations and/or integration, Arrigo BMS offers an open platform for client and server scripting. Arrigo BMS uses JavaScript (ECMA script 6 as standard), which enables advanced logic, data mining, SQL access, implementation of custom functions, and access to other applications and APIs.

Security, access and permissions

Arrigo offers a selection of integrated security models and options, including:

  • Passwords and user information are stored on the server and use a Sha256 password hash algorithm.
  • User permissions in the Arrigo program are based on responsibilities and authority.
  • Microsoft Windows Authentication manages rights to Arrigo users, authenticated on a domain controller or local computer, based on the user's identity and group membership
  • Customers using the Arrigo platform benefit from secure integration, all the way down to individual data elements or attributes
  • Secure communication via http and WebSocket via TLS 1.3 encrypted connection (HTTPS and WSS)
